Tarocco Sciara x Clementine (Citrus sinensis x Citrus clementina)
DESCRIPTION
Tarocco Sciara x Clementine (Citrus sinensis x Citrus clementina) is a hybrid between an orange and a clementine (Tacle).
It’s so particular because of the colour and the taste.
PLANT
-Tree features: Very vigorous with long branches.
-Leaves: Big leaves, similar to those of Tarocco oranges. Fooliage is green and intense.
Sometimes we can find thorns.
FRUIT
-Taste: Tarocco sciara x Clementine is very sweet, with an intense vanilla/clementine/orange flavour
-Colour: Orange intense. It can become red pigmented on February, depending on climate conditions, just like a blood orange.
Pulp can be orange, to bloody orange according to winter conditions too.
SEASON OF RIPENESS
It starts to ripen from December to February.
It usually blooms during spring. Flowers are white and very fragrant.
HOW TO USE IT
-In the Kitchen: We can use it like an orange. It’s very juicy and sweet.
-Ornamental: It’s a beautiful plant to enrich your garden.
COLD RESISTENCE
According to our tests, in the Greenhouse, or in a covered area, it can resist to a temperature of -8°C
This variety needs to be grown like a normal Lemon.
